Rareview Coffee & Restaurant
Description
Khao soi gai arrives with floating chopsticks over a deep, northern-style curry broth, and it is the thing to order in Lanta Old Town. The chef’s Chinese-Thai background shows in the balance: rich coconut, proper spice, crisp noodles, no sugary tourist-curry fog.
Moo hong – caramelised pork – is another strong pick, soft enough to abandon its structural duties at the first nudge of a fork. The oversized fish cakes, massaman curry, steamed fish and pad krapao hold their own, while pineapple fried rice is more serious than its holiday-menu reputation suggests.
The tables facing the water get the point of the place: stilt-house Old Town, mangrove edge, boats and a long view across the bay. Sit outside near sunset with a whole-coconut smoothie or coffee, then let the tide provide the background theatre (far cheaper than a West End ticket, and with better curry).
The approach runs past the kitchen and a storage-heavy interior section before the waterfront opens up. Rareview suits diners who want Thai cooking with care and presentation, not a rushed snack between souvenir shops; the khao soi is better reason enough to make the detour down Old Town’s main street.
